Happy Feet

Shelby and I went to see the movie Happy Feet this afternoon. I give it a 4 out of 10. Really the only reason I rated it so high was because of Robin Williams. He had some really witty lines. There were also some great musical numbers. My little girl wanted to leave halfway through the movie. But, I was not going to leave since we dropped $21 for the both of us to watch it. It was pretty dark/depressing to me. I mean, the end of the movie had a good point to it, but the overall theme of the movie was just dreary. I would not recommend it to smaller children. They lose interest in the plot really quickly and the sea lions REALLY scared mine! It was a great waste of time in my opinion.
